The MAGA-World Rift Over Trump’s Qatari Jet


As Air Drive One glided into Doha immediately, it was straightforward to think about President Donald Trump having a case of jet envy.

Hamad Worldwide Airport, in Qatar’s capital, is usually dwelling to the $400 million “palace within the sky,” a luxurious liner that Trump is eyeing. Qatar’s royal household plans to present the aircraft to Trump as a brief alternative for the getting old Air Drive One after which to his future presidential library after he leaves workplace. The Qatari plane was in Texas, not Doha, through the tarmac welcome ceremony that Trump obtained on the second cease of his Center East journey. However questions concerning the reward’s safety and ethics have shadowed all the week.

Trump has privately defended accepting the Qatari aircraft as a alternative for the present Air Drive One, which dates to 1990. He has instructed aides and advisers that it’s “humiliating” for the president of the US to fly in an outdated aircraft and that international leaders will giggle at him if he reveals up at summits within the older plane, a White Home official and an out of doors adviser instructed us, granted anonymity to debate personal conversations. The surface adviser stated that Trump has additionally mused about persevering with to make use of the Qatari aircraft after he departs the White Home.

However in a uncommon second of defiance, among the loudest cries of protest concerning the attainable reward are coming from a few of Trump’s staunchest allies. “I feel if we switched the names to Hunter Biden and Joe Biden, we’d all be freaking out on the proper,” Ben Shapiro, a Each day Wire co-founder, stated on his podcast. “President Trump promised to empty the swamp. This isn’t, in truth, draining the swamp.”

Even in Washington, a capital now numbed to scandals that have been as soon as unthinkable, the thought of accepting the jet is jaw-dropping. Trump’s second administration is but once more displaying a disregard for norms and for conventional authorized and political guardrails round elected workplace—this time at a very gargantuan scale. Trump’s staff has stated it believes that the reward could be authorized as a result of it might be donated to the Division of Protection (after which to the presidential library). However federal regulation prohibits authorities employees from accepting a present bigger than $20 at anybody time from any particular person. Retired Normal Stanley McChrystal, who as soon as commanded U.S. forces in Afghanistan, instructed us that he couldn’t “settle for a lunch on the Capital Grille.” Former federal workers shared related reactions on social media.

“These of us who served within the army couldn’t settle for a cup of espresso and a doughnut at a contractor website due to the looks of impropriety,” retired Air Drive Colonel Moe Davis, who additionally labored as a army prosecutor at Guantánamo Bay, wrote on X. “Now Trump is taking a 747 airplane from the federal government of Qatar for his private use … grift and corruption run amuck.”

Air Drive One is essentially the most well-known plane on the planet, an immediately recognizable image of American energy. Greater than that, it’s a White Home within the sky, one outfitted with sufficient top-of-the-line safety and communications gear to run the federal government if wanted. Famously, it harbored President George W. Bush for hours after the fear assaults of September 11, 2001, maintaining him protected till he may safely return to Washington. Technically, any aircraft a president boards will get the enduring Air Drive One name signal. However when most individuals consider the aircraft, they image the extremely modified Boeing 747-200B plane, with its Kennedy-era light-blue, gold, and white coloration scheme. (There are literally two equivalent variations of the aircraft, considered one of which is normally used for added employees on lengthy international journeys. A smaller model can be used domestically for airports with brief runways.)

Allowing a international authorities to produce the signature American plane strikes many individuals as not simply unpatriotic, but in addition an outrageous safety threat. Though U.S. relations with Qatar have improved, particularly as Doha has emerged as an important mediator within the Israel-Hamas conflict, the Gulf nation has beforehand supported terror teams. With the intention to be swept for listening units and introduced as much as American-military requirements, the Qatari plane would probably must be disassembled, inspected, after which rebuilt, a painstaking course of that may take years and value taxpayers tons of of thousands and thousands of {dollars}. Boeing was alleged to ship a alternative for Air Drive One final yr, however vital delays have value the aircraft maker billions on the mission. The White Home estimated final month {that a} new aircraft may not be prepared till 2029; Boeing just lately stated that its aim is 2027.

For some in MAGA world, Trump’s choice to simply accept a aircraft from a Gulf state is the antithesis of his “America First” international coverage. It additionally clashes along with his financial agenda to return manufacturing jobs and initiatives to the US. Laura Loomer, whose affect with Trump helped result in a current purge on the Nationwide Safety Council, has blasted the thought, posting on X, “That is actually going to be such a stain on the admin if that is true. And I say that as somebody who would take a bullet for Trump. I’m so upset.” Mark Levin, one other influential conservative voice, replied, “Ditto.”

Trump’s eagerness to simply accept such a lavish reward from a Center Japanese energy has put congressional Republicans within the awkward-but-familiar place of defending a transfer that they might denounce have been it made by a Democratic president. Some have criticized the thought—gently. “I definitely have issues,” Senator Ted Cruz of Texas instructed CNBC. Saying he was “not a fan of Qatar,” Cruz warned that the aircraft would pose “vital espionage and surveillance issues.” Senator Roger Wicker of Mississippi, the chairman of the Armed Companies Committee, additionally panned the provide, telling Politico that “it might be like the US transferring into the Qatari embassy.”

Others have proven extra willingness than regular to interrupt with Trump. Borrowing the president’s description of his financial coverage, Senator Josh Hawley of Missouri instructed reporters that “it might be higher if Air Drive One have been an enormous, stunning jet made in the US of America.” Senator Rick Scott of Florida was extra blunt, telling The Hill: “I’m not flying on a Qatari aircraft. They help Hamas.” And Senator Cynthia Lummis of Wyoming burst into laughter when requested by reporters in a Capitol hall if accepting the jet could be a good suggestion.

But GOP leaders have proven no indication that they plan to launch something resembling the aggressive, prolonged investigations they performed into the international entanglements of Hunter Biden or, in an earlier period, Hillary Clinton. Speaker Mike Johnson tried to attract a distinction between what he characterised because the secretive dealings of “the Biden crime household” and Trump’s seemingly extra clear dealmaking. “No matter President Trump is doing is out within the open,” Johnson instructed reporters this morning. “They’re not making an attempt to hide something.”

The speaker made little pretense of disguising the truth that a Republican-controlled Congress is unlikely to probe a Republican president, irrespective of how questionable their actions. Whereas GOP leaders framed their investigations into the Bidens and the Clintons because the solemn duty of the legislative department, Johnson’s remarks immediately handled Congress’s oversight position as virtually an afterthought. “I’ve received to be involved with working the Home of Representatives, and that’s what I do,” he stated. “Congress has oversight duty, however I feel, as far as I do know, the ethics are all being adopted.”

The Senate’s prime Democrat, Minority Chief Chuck Schumer, declared that he would place a maintain on all the president’s Division of Justice nominees till the attainable transaction is scrutinized.

Trump appears to see no issues with accepting the reward. He referred to as a reporter a “silly particular person” for questioning its appropriateness, including, “I’d by no means be one to show down that form of a suggestion.” And in a Reality Social publish despatched at 2:50 a.m. native time in Saudi Arabia immediately, earlier than his arrival in Doha, he wrote, “Why ought to our army, and subsequently our taxpayers, be compelled to pay tons of of thousands and thousands of {Dollars} after they can get it for FREE.” He added, “Solely a FOOL wouldn’t settle for this reward on behalf of our Nation.”

Once I requested the White Home for additional remark, a spokesperson pointed me to the president’s publish. Trump has been pissed off with the present Air Drive One for years and had thought that the brand new model—which was commissioned throughout his first time period in workplace—could be prepared for his second.

For years, the big majority of Republicans have chosen to disregard Trump’s efforts to capitalize on the presidency to complement himself and his household. Regardless of his guarantees, the president by no means did launch his tax returns or completely divest himself from his enterprise in his first time period (his two eldest sons merely took over the day-to-day operations). Trump ignored the emoluments clause of the Structure, which prohibits elected officers from accepting presents from international states, sparking a number of lawsuits. Maybe his most egregious instance of pay-to-play was the Trump Worldwide Lodge, within the towering previous post-office constructing just some blocks from the White Home. When a international delegation came around Washington, a nice solution to curry favor with the chief govt was to lease a block of rooms on the resort. And taxpayer {dollars} flowed into the Trump household’s coffers each time he spent a weekend at considered one of his personal resorts, the place he required employees and Secret Service brokers to remain there.

The Trump Worldwide Lodge was offered throughout Trump’s 4 years out of workplace, however the president’s efforts to revenue have turn into solely extra blatant. His enterprise has made a transfer into cryptocurrency with a pair of “meme cash” and an alternate referred to as World Liberty Monetary, which points its personal token, simply as Trump is able to again crypto-friendly laws. An public sale involving one of many meme cash, $TRUMP, concluded this week, with the highest holders of the coin profitable a dinner with Trump and a personal tour of the White Home. And American Bitcoin, a crypto-mining agency backed by the Trump sons, will quickly go public, which means that buyers at dwelling and overseas will be capable to pour cash into the corporate.

Trump’s aides have targeted on hanging enterprise offers whereas the president is within the Center East this week—the White Home introduced $1.2 trillion in agreements with Qatar immediately, together with a deal for the Arab state to purchase $96 billion in Boeing jets—whereas additionally quietly making an attempt to make headway on an Iran nuclear deal and a cease-fire in Gaza. However the journey has once more solid a highlight on the Trump household’s enterprise ties to lands not lined by his “America First” rhetoric. Trump arrived in Qatar two weeks after his son Eric Trump inked a deal to develop a $5.5 billion golf membership simply north of Doha. The Trump Group has additionally secured new offers in Saudi Arabia and the United Arab Emirates, the opposite stops on the president’s journey.

“If he can get himself a aircraft, he’ll be laughing his solution to the financial institution,” Anthony Scaramucci, the previous Trump official turned Trump critic, instructed us. “However I feel it’s simply on the market as a crimson herring to distract from the even greater issues that he’s doing for himself.”
